Given:
e^(-2)=0.1353
Take (natural) log on both sides:
log(e^(-2))=log(0.1353) ...(1)
Since log(base n)n^x = x
then log<sub>e</sub>e^x = x
We rewrite the previous expression (1) as
-2 = log<sub>e</sub>(0.1353)
or
log<sub>e</sub>(0.1353) = -2
